
Publisher refint/games and developer Falcom have delayed crossover fighting game Ys vs. Trails in the Sky: Alternative Saga from its previously planned summer release window by a few months, the companies announced. It will be available for PlayStation 5, PlayStation 4, Switch, and PC via Steam, Epic Games Store, and GOG.
